Physical Events
Occurrences or phenomena that involve changes in the state or motion of physical objects.
Solipsism
The view that we can know only of the existence of our own minds: sometimes called the egocentric predicament.
Emotions
Complex psychological states that involve physical arousal, expressive behaviors, and conscious experience.
Feelings
Emotional states or reactions that are subjectively experienced as pleasant or unpleasant sensations.
